At Curriculum Associates, we believe in the potential of every child and are changing the face of education technology with award-winning learning programs like i-Ready that serve a third of the nation’s K–8 students. For more than 50 years, our commitment to making classrooms better places, serving educators, and supporting accessible learning experiences for all students has driven the continuous improvement of our innovative programs. Our team of more than 2,500 employees is composed of lifelong learners who stand behind this mission, working tirelessly to serve the educational community with world-class programs and support every day.
Summary:
The Senior DevOps Engineer is responsible for designing, automating, and maintaining the Azure-based developer environments that support the company's developer community, including sandbox, development, and test environments, self-service provisioning, and the CI/CD pipelines that connect them to production. This individual will build and support the tooling, automation, and monitoring solutions that enable developers to spin up, test, and ship reliable, secure, and scalable systems with minimal friction. The ideal candidate will possess strong automation and scripting skills, a willingness to learn new technologies, and be able to effectively work as part of a multifunctional group in a collaborative environment.

Benefits and Pay Range:
Pay Range – This role’s range is $93,250 - $166,250 The wage range for this role takes into account the wide range of factors that Curriculum Associates considers in making compensation decisions based on our Compensation Philosophy. Actual base pay within that range will vary based upon several factors including, but not limited to, prior experience and relevant skill sets. At Curriculum Associates, it is not typical for an individual to be hired at or near the top of the range for their role and compensation decisions are dependent on the facts and circumstances for each case. This role is also eligible to participate in the company bonus plan. The Company recognizes that minimum wage varies by location and will ensure all compensation decisions comply with applicable state and local laws.
Benefits – Benefit eligible employees (and their families) are covered by medical, dental, vision, and basic life insurance. Employees can enroll in our company’s 401k plan and receive an employer match. Employees have access to a flexible vacation and sick policy in addition to twelve paid holidays and a winter office closure between Christmas and New Year's, as well as a number of additional perks and benefits.
